Rutherford County Volunteers of Year to be honored by Governor

 

Two Rutherford County volunteers will be honored at the Governor’s Tennessee Stars Awards in March.  The program honors one adult volunteer and one youth volunteer from each county in the state.  This year’s Rutherford county honorees are Heinz Kokemueller and Ella Edge.

heinzHeinz has been volunteering at the Alvin C. York VA Medical Center since 2001 and has logged more than 5,500 volunteer hours. Heinz is a dedicated volunteer who drives for their on-site shuttle service two days a week. He provides rides for Veterans and their families throughout the Medical Center Campus to and from the parking lots and various buildings on campus. Heinz has a positive, helpful attitude and greets everyone with a smile! Staff say that he is a valuable member of the VA Tennessee Valley Healthcare System volunteer team. Heinz is an Army Veteran serving 2 years as a Chief Radio Operator in the Korean War, stationed at Osan Air Force Base in South Korea.

Ella is an 12 year old student at Central Magnet school. Last year, while attending McFadden Elementary, her school had a Vendors Fair and she set up face painting at the end of her father’s booth. Only asking for donations for the Lions Club, she painted faces by herself for over four hours collecting $60. The money she raised for the Lions Club will help to pay for glasses for those in need.

 Ella is a committed member of the Murfreesboro Lions club. She is always first to volunteer to help: she shows up to sell pecans at Kroger’s, works in the dining room during the Pancake Breakfast and always takes time to count glasses that are donated. At Central she is on the principals list and is involved in Science Olympiad and is becoming an avid rock climber. She also volunteers her time outside of Lions club. Her last year at McFadden she was also the treasurer for the Elementary Honors Society where they helped Boulevard Terrace Nursing Home with their gardens. As a thank you to McFadden Elementary she, along with others, helped clean up the school’s garden as well.

Heinz and Ella were selected from a pool of 52 outstanding volunteers who were recognized in Volunteer Rutherford’s Volunteer of the Week program throughout 2017.  The program, sponsored by Guaranty Trust Company, is open to nominations from all Volunteer Rutherford registered agencies.
